As a renter, a cluttered home can be a source of great anxiety and frustration. Nonetheless, the way of decluttering a home can appear like a nonstop battle with your stuff.
In lieu of simply moving things around, professionals propose implementing a few specific strategies to help you declutter your home daily. In reality, by sticking to these five simple suggestions, you may just eliminate clutter from your rental home constantly.
Start Small
Trying to declutter your entire house simultaneously is an outstanding method to get overwhelmed, and consequently, nothing will change. Rather, commence with a modest beginning. Give 5 or 10 minutes each day to center on removing clutter from a single area. After a few days, you will begin to see a real difference in the amount of clutter in your house.
Give Unused Items Away
Most of us have unused items simply taking up space in our homes and storerooms. Try selecting just one item to give away each day. That could accumulate to 365 products in a single year! The following is a straightforward method for determining which clothes to keep and which you could donate: Rotate all of your hangers in the opposite direction. As you wear each item, turn the hangers back in the correct orientation. Over several months, gather up everything you haven’t worn and donate them.
Use a Trash Bag
The trash bag approach may be considered if you are prepared for a more challenging task. To leverage this approach, acquire a large trash bag and patrol the residence in search of items that are neither necessary nor utilized. As rapidly as possible, fill the bag with items, and then donate or give the items away.
Create a Decluttering Checklist
Decluttering your home is significantly simpler when you have clearly defined tasks. Moreover, you can track your progress by checking off each item as it gets done. Using a checklist, focus on decluttering a little at a time for just a few minutes daily.
Use the Box Method
Using the box method is a fast and effective method to declutter an area. Label a number of containers with terms such as Keep, Give Away, Trash, or Re-Locate. Going one room at a time, take each item and place it into one of the boxes. Do not cease until every single item is in a box. Continue by donating, re-locating, or throwing away the items in the corresponding container.
An additional variation of this method is having baskets belonging to each household member. As the containers are full, each individual must put their items away in their designated locations on a daily basis. Using these approaches, you can declutter your entire house one box or basket at a time.
No matter which decluttering tip you begin with, implementing it can assist you in gaining control over the clutter in your home and maintain a minimal amount every day.
